In today’s modern society, the kitchen has evolved from being just a place to cook and prepare meals to becoming the heart of the home. “life kitchens” have emerged as a new concept that combines functionality with style, creating a space that is not only practical but also a reflection of one’s personality and lifestyle.
life kitchens are designed to be more than just a place to cook; they are meant to be a space where families can come together, socialize, and create memories. These kitchens are often open-concept, with islands or breakfast bars that provide a central gathering place for family and friends. The layout is designed to maximize efficiency and functionality, with ample storage and workspace to make cooking and meal prep a breeze.
One of the key features of life kitchens is their attention to detail and design. From custom cabinetry to high-end appliances, these kitchens are built to be both beautiful and practical. Natural materials like wood and stone are often used to create a warm and inviting atmosphere, while modern finishes and fixtures add a touch of sophistication.
In addition to being aesthetically pleasing, life kitchens are also designed to be eco-friendly and sustainable. Energy-efficient appliances, LED lighting, and recycled materials are just a few of the ways that these kitchens are helping to reduce their environmental impact. Many homeowners are also opting for smart technology in their kitchens, with features like touchless faucets, voice-activated appliances, and integrated home automation systems.
But perhaps the most important aspect of a life kitchen is its ability to adapt to the changing needs of its users. As families grow and evolve, so too should their kitchen. This means that life kitchens are designed with flexibility in mind, allowing for easy updates and modifications as needed. Whether it’s adding a new appliance, reconfiguring the layout, or simply changing the color scheme, life kitchens are built to last a lifetime.
